Transaction 77e86d569f3885eab45de0fcf4edf8b673dc39712b47d607cf573401486b0aa0
1 Input
1 Output
-
77e86d569f3885eab45de0fcf4edf8b673dc39712b47d607cf573401486b0aa0:0
- value
- 276923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40cdefaabe387249733e20c96c0f5306d9a3868d OP_EQUAL
- address
- 37bfsX3hi2DWGXRHsMb2kbGJyRbXa7fLv2